Is Darius Auff the SEC's Top Freshman for Arkansas Basketball?

Darius Auff SEC's Top Freshman featured with basketball theme and Arkansas logo.


Arkansas Hoops: A Strong Contender for SEC Freshman of the Year

As college football kicks off, Arkansas basketball fans are equally enthusiastic about what lies ahead for the Razorbacks. The spotlight has recently fallen on Darius Auff, a freshman with significant potential who could be a frontrunner for SEC Freshman of the Year. In the latest episode of Pod at the Palace, host Curtis Wilkerson highlights not just the team's upcoming season but also the impressive talent entering the program.


In 'Arkansas A Favorite For EXPLOSIVE Wing | Is Acuff SEC's Top Freshman?', the discussion highlights the exciting talent arriving at Arkansas, prompting us to examine what's ahead for the Razorbacks this season.

Introducing Darius Auff

Darius Auff arrives at Arkansas with high expectations. Standing at 6'2" and showcasing an impressive skill set, Auff has proven himself during his high school years. His evaluation shows him as a ready-to-contribute player, likely to be a primary scorer for the Razorbacks. As Wilkerson explained, "I think that AUF is more equipped and ready to be that guy as a freshman." His scoring ability, combined with growth as a facilitator, places him at the heart of Arkansas's strategy this season.

The Competition: Who Will Challenge Auff?

While Darius Auff may be in the lead, he will face stiff competition this coming season from fellow freshman Native Mint of Tennessee and Malik Thomas of Arkansas. According to Wilkerson, the recognition for these players is not to be underestimated. For example, Thomas possesses incredible offensive skills similar to Auff’s but remains a wildcard due to his projected role on the team.

Early Signs of Promise

With the Razorbacks looking to regain strength after last season, the chemistry fostered by returning players alongside newcomers will be crucial. The management of the group, including strategic utilization of potential assets like Auff, will shape the way this team performs. As Wilkerson notes, "I do think that Darius Auff will probably be the favorite going into the season for SEC freshman of the year." As obvious preparations begin, the basketball community will watch eagerly.

The buzz around Arkansas basketball is palpable. With an impressive recruiting class and a focus on player development, the Razorbacks are set for an exciting season. Fans should keep their eyes peeled for Darius Auff, as he may just be the next big star on Arkansas’ court.

LPGA Returns to Rogers: The Walmart NW Arkansas Championship Presented by P&G

World's Best Women Golfers Converge on Northwest ArkansasRogers, Arkansas — Beginning this week, the world’s best women golfers converge on Pinnacle Country Club for the prestigious Walmart NW Arkansas Championship presented by P&G. The 2025 edition of this LPGA Tour stop promises thrilling competition, community festivities, and plenty of storylines. History & VenueThe tournament has been held at Pinnacle Country Club since its debut in 2007, and it has grown into a cornerstone event on the LPGA schedule. NWA Championship+2Wikipedia+2Pinnacle is a challenging 18-hole course (Par 71), redesigned in 2008 by Randy Heckenkemper. Its layout features a demanding mix of long par 5s, tricky par 3s, and holes that reward strategic tee shots and precision. Wikipedia+1The purse for the tournament in recent years has been $3 million, with the winner’s share in 2024 at $450,000. Media+2Wikipedia+2 What’s New & What’s At StakeField & Players: Expect a strong field, including many of the top-ranked LPGA professionals. Arkansas alums and local favorites also add to the intrigue. NWA Championship+2LPGA+2Fan & Community Events: More than just golf — the championship week features side events like the BITE Experience food festival, the Walmart & P&G Kids Confidence Club, junior golf initiatives, and a 5K benefiting local causes. It’s become a significant event for the Northwest Arkansas area. 5 News Online+2NWA Championship+2Sustainability & Access: The event is GEO Certified for sustainability, one of only a couple LPGA tournaments with that distinction. Ticket pricing remains accessible with free or discounted access for children, military, first responders, and families. Rogers-Lowell Chamber+1Key Players & Past ChampionsThe reigning champion, Jasmine Suwannapura, claimed the 2024 title in dramatic fashion, using an eagle on the second playoff hole to edge out Lucy Li. LPGA+1Other recent champions include Atthaya Thitikul (2022), Hae Ran Ryu (2023), and Nasa Hataoka, which speaks to the level of competition and how tight the margins often are. WikipediaWatch for standouts in putting, experience in playoff situations, and those who can handle pressure over Sunday’s final stretch.What to Watch ForCourse conditions & strategy: Pinnacle’s re-design means the long par 5s and precise par 3s will test both length and accuracy off the tee. A windy day or firm greens could separate the leaders.Momentum players: Those coming in with recent strong finishes could use that confidence late in the season.Playoff potential: Given past history (e.g., 2024), this event often comes down to clutch moments. Expect nerves, opportunity, and possibly extra holes to decide the champion.Final ThoughtsThe Walmart NW Arkansas Championship is more than just another stop on the LPGA calendar — it’s a community event, a marker of prestige, and a test of skill under pressure. Whether you follow for the drama, the local flavor, or the golf itself, this week at Pinnacle Country Club will be one to remember.
